Commission Implementing Regulation (EU) 2017/754 of 28 April 2017 opening and providing for the management of Union tariff quotas for certain agricultural and processed agricultural products originating in Ecuador

Commission Implementing Regulation (EU) 2017/754 of 28 April 2017 opening and providing for the management of Union tariff quotas for certain agricultural and processed agricultural products originating in Ecuador THE EUROPEAN COMMISSION, Having regard to the Treaty on the Functioning of the European Union, Having regard to Regulation (EU) No 952/2013 of the European Parliament and of the Council of 9 October 2013 laying down the Union Customs Code OJ L 269, 10.10.2013, p. 1. , and in particular Article 58(1) thereof, Whereas: (1) By Decision (EU) 2016/2369 Council Decision (EU) 2016/2369 of 11 November 2016 on the signing, on behalf of the Union, and provisional application of the Protocol of Accession to the Trade Agreement between the European Union and its Member States, of the one part, and Colombia and Peru, of the other part, to take account of the accession of Ecuador (OJ L 356, 24.12.2016, p. 1). (the Decision), the Council authorised the signing, on behalf of the Union, of the Protocol of Accession (the Protocol) to the Trade Agreement between the European Union and its Member States, of the one part, and Colombia and Peru (the Agreement), of the other part, to take account of the accession of Ecuador to the Agreement and provided for the provisional application of the Protocol from 1 January 2017 OJ L 358, 29.12.2016, p. 1. . (2) The Agreement stipulates that customs duties on imports into the Union of goods originating in Ecuador are to be reduced or eliminated in accordance with the tariff elimination schedule in Annex I to the Agreement. Annex I provides that, for certain goods originating in Ecuador, the reduction or elimination of customs duties is granted within tariff quotas. (3) The tariff quotas set out in subsection 3 to Section B of Appendix 1 of Annex I to the Agreement should be managed by the Commission on the basis of the chronological order of dates of acceptance of customs declarations for release for free circulation in accordance with Commission Implementing Regulation (EU) 2015/2447 Commission Implementing Regulation (EU) 2015/2447 of 24 November 2015 laying down detailed rules for implementing certain provisions of Regulation (EU) No 952/2013 of the European Parliament and of the Council laying down the Union Customs Code (OJ L 343, 29.12.2015, p. 558). . (4) In order to ensure the smooth application and management of the quota system granted under the Protocol, this Regulation should apply from the same date as that of the provisional application of the Protocol. (5) The measures provided for in this Regulation are in accordance with the opinion of the Customs Code Committee, HAS ADOPTED THIS REGULATION:
Article 1
Union tariff quotas are opened for goods originating in Ecuador as set out in the Annex.
Article 2
The tariff quotas set out in the Annex shall be managed in accordance with Articles 49 to 54 of Implementing Regulation (EU) 2015/2447.
Article 3
This Regulation shall enter into force on the third day following that of its publication in the Official Journal of the European Union.
It shall apply from 1 January 2017. This Regulation shall be binding in its entirety and directly applicable in all Member States. Done at Brussels, 28 April 2017. For the Commission The President Jean-Claude Juncker
Annex
ANNEX Notwithstanding the rules for the interpretation of the Combined Nomenclature, the wording of the description of the products in the fifth column of the table is to be considered as having no more than an indicative value. The preferential scheme is determined, within the context of this Annex, by the scope of the CN codes set out in the third column of the table as applicable at the time of adoption of this Regulation. Where ex CN codes are indicated, the preferential scheme is to be determined by application of the CN codes and corresponding descriptions in the fifth column of the table taken together.
